Lionel Messi (39, Inter Miami) was issued a post-match fine by Major League Soccer (MLS) for assaulting an opposing player during a game.
The MLS Disciplinary Committee officially announced on the 22nd that it imposed a fine on Messi for violating regulations during the 21st round of the 2026 regular season match against Philadelphia Union, which took place on the 20th (Korea time).
The specific amount of the fine has not been disclosed, and no suspension was included, so there will be no obstacle to his participation in the next match.
The incident occurred just before the end of the match, during stoppage time in the second half, when both teams were locked in a frustrating 2-2 tie. While engaging in a fierce challenge with Philadelphia's Quinn Sullivan (22), Messi protested after Sullivan raised his elbow high, leading to a heated exchange. As the tension escalated, Messi lost control of his emotions and swung his hand at Sullivan's head and neck area while the ball was not in play.

At the time, the referee could not see the strike due to an obstructed view and did not pull out a card. However, broadcast footage showing the violent act spread immediately after the match, and the MLS office confirmed the post-match penalty after reviewing video replay.
Meanwhile, Messi delivered an outstanding performance in his return match following his father's funeral, including scoring a goal, but lost his composure at the end of the game, committing a violent act that left him with a blemish on his record.
In addition to Messi, four players from Inter Miami, including Ian Fray, were included in the disciplinary list for various rule violations on this day.
